Description
An Afghan family celebrates Nowruz, the Persian New Year, in the privacy of their home, as the country's Taliban rulers consider the festival "illegal". The celebrations include cooking traditional dishes, visiting relatives and going for picnics. Nowruz marks the first day of spring and is celebrated on the day of the astronomical vernal equinox, which usually occurs on March 21. It is celebrated as the beginning of the new year by millions across the world, including many in Afghanistan. Nowruz was previously celebrated widely in the Muslim-majority country, but it is now considered "illegal" by the country's ultra-conservative Taliban rulers though they do not stop people outright from celebrating it.
